Personal development is the process of assessing the skills and qualities that are possessed by a person and developing or enhancing it so that they can use these skills to fulfill their aim in life and achieve their goals by maximizing their potential. There are many personal values that are needed to be incorporated in a good leader. The personal values which should be present are wisdom & knowledge, humanity, temperance, transcendence, justice and courage. These personal values are very important to be present in a leader so that they may be able to act in the right manner and help his team members to do the right thing. Moreover, there are certain attributes in a leader that would be helpful for the society. A leader has to be very advanced and this is where the main purpose of personal development comes in. Personal development does not only mean developing the characteristics, it also means that the leader should change himself according to the changes in technology.  The cycle or planning process of personal development begins with establishing the purpose or direction of our development, identifying our needs, then identifying the opportunities of learning, formulating the plan of action, undertaking the development, recording the outcomes and finally evaluating and reviewing the results of the outcome (Appendix 6.1). The next step to making the personal development plan is to conduct a personal PEST analysis. The PEST analysis determines the Political, Economic, Socio-Cultural and Environmental environments around us. The policies or the government decisions which affect us are the political factors. Any new laws or regulations which create an impact upon us, whether directly or indirectly come under this section. The economic aspects of my country can create a huge impact on my development process, hence it is important to understand those factors and determine the changes that will possibly occur in the next five years so that I am able to make the development plan accordingly. Next, the societal trends that are into existence at the moment are important for me to determine so that I may be able to grab any opportunity which might help me to achieve my goal faster and better. The demographic trends, lifestyle trends, family trends are a few of the recent trends that could be determined by my plan. Lastly, technological factors play a major role in determining the course of my plan and action. Technology changes very quickly with time and these changes are very important in the formulation of any kind of plan as this can make my work harder or easier. Technology can influence the kind of work that I do and help me in the fulfilment of my plan faster (Appendix 6.3). The GROW model is said to be one of the most established models of coaching and development. The model was created by Sir John Whitmore along with his colleagues in the year 1980s. The model later became popular from his best-selling book which was Coaching for Performance. The GROW model is a powerful told which helps to highlight the inner ability and potential of individuals through different coaching steps which if followed can help in the personal development of a person. This model is precise for problem solving and goal setting and helps to maximize the personal productivity and achievements. The full form of GROW model is Goals, Reality, Options and Will. These four steps are the main key features of the GROW model (Gail Thomas & Hamnson, 2014). Going through these steps will help to determine the awareness and understanding of the individuals. The GROW model will help the person to come to terms with their own aspirations, situations and belief. The model will enable the individuals to achieve both their personal and professional goals, which will instil confidence and self-motivation among the people. The G stands for Goal which is the finishing point, where the individual wants to reach. The goal has to be set in such a way that is understandable and evident to the individual. The R stands for Reality which is the present situation of the individual, the present challenges and issues that are being faced by them and how far they are from achieving the set goal. The O stands for Obstacles or Options which are the obstacles that would be faced by the individuals which will stop them to achieve their set goals. The absence of obstacles will help the individuals to reach their goals faster. After identifying the obstacles, the individual needs to find different options to reach their goals. The W stands for Way Forward or Will which enables the options to be converted to action which will help them to go one step further in fulfilling their target or goal. The GROW model has a great impact on self-awareness and realizing the responsibility that they have to take on to develop themselves to reach their desired goals.
